With the Minnesota Vikings already eliminated from earning a spot in the 2025 playoffs, there isn't much time left in the regular season for players to prove they deserve more time on the field next year.
Unfortunately, edge rusher Jonathan Greenard won't be among the Vikings participating in the team's final three games this season, as Minnesota revealed on Monday that he will miss the remainder of the 2025 campaign to undergo surgery for an injured shoulder.
With Greenard unavailable, the Vikings will turn to second-year edge rusher Dallas Turner to help pick up the slack.
